About Chen Weng
Chen Weng is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ery, Genetics, Cell Biology and Physiology, having authored 17 papers that have together received 330 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Single-cell and spatial transcriptomics (5 papers), Pancreatic function and diabetes (3 papers), Advanced Fluorescence Microscopy Techniques (2 papers), Genetics and Neurodevelopmental Disorders (2 papers), Cell Image Analysis Techniques (1 paper), Error Correcting Code Techniques (1 paper), Bee Products Chemical Analysis (1 paper)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Developmental Neuroscience (14 citations), Genetics (92 citations), Cancer Research (49 citations), Molecular Biology (194 citations) and Clinical Biochemistry (15 citations). Chen Weng has collaborated with scholars based in United States, China and Taiwan. Frequent co-authors include Fulai Jin, Vijay G. Sankaran, Fulong Yu, Sisi Lai, Leina Lu, Yun Li, Carlos Alfonso Álvarez‐González, Haiyan Li, Anthony Wynshaw‐Boris and Yan Li. Their work appears in journals such as Cancer Cell, International Journal of Biological Macromolecules, Nature Communications, Cell Reports and Nature Biotechnology.
